The Guinness Index

How the score
is calculated.

Every score comes from someone who sat at that bar and drank that pint. No stars, no algorithms — just honest reviews from people who care about a good glass. We ask three things.

01
Presentation
Head, dome, lacing — does it look like it was pulled with care?
02
Texture
Creamy or watery? A good Guinness coats the glass.
03
Taste
Roast, balance, bitter finish — the full experience.

Each dimension is rated 1–10. The Index score is the average, shown as a 0–5 pint rating.
